Mobile vs Ogden-Clearfield
Fair Market Rent Comparison — HUD 2025 Data
Quick Answer
Mobile is 41% cheaper for renters. A 2-bedroom rents for $746/mo vs $1,050/mo in Ogden-Clearfield — saving $3,648/year.
Rent by Unit Size
| Unit Size | Mobile | Ogden-Clearfield |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Studio | $495 | $721 | $226 |
| 1 Bedroom | $626 | $862 | $236 |
| 2 Bedrooms | $746 | $1,050 | $304 |
| 3 Bedrooms | $958 | $1,335 | $377 |
| 4 Bedrooms | $1,154 | $1,563 | $409 |
| Median Income | $43,599 | $68,654 | $25,055 |
